Introduction to the Changsha China-Africa Economic and Trade Fair
The Changsha China-Africa Economic and Trade Fair is a landmark event designed to strengthen economic ties and trade cooperation between China and African countries. Held in Changsha, Hunan Province, this fair serves as a vibrant platform for businesses, governments, and organizations to explore opportunities, negotiate deals, and foster partnerships that benefit both continents.

Opportunities for Businesses
For businesses, the fair opens doors to new markets and investment opportunities. African businesses can showcase their products to a vast Chinese audience, while Chinese companies can explore the untapped potential of African markets. The event also features seminars and workshops, providing valuable insights into market trends, regulatory frameworks, and business strategies.
